New Grange (or Newgrange) was an ancient passage tomb in Ireland, built in the Neolithic period, and built to allow for the light of the winter solstice to illuminate the passage for a short period of time. Discovered in the late seventeenth century, it is one of the most famous prehistoric structures in the world. Connely's Inn is located not far from the site.
